In total there are 23 such churches, the probably best known are listed below: Coptic ... WebFeb 12, 2016 · Catholic clergy are celibate, while Eastern or Orthodox clergy are allowed to marry. The churches also differ in the practice of the eucharist or communion ritual. The Roman Catholic Church uses unleavened bread for the communion host, while the Orthodox churches use leavened bread. “There were even disagreements on a real …
